Output 3595169e2271f77326251626e8356665ccbd6aade5078a9874e678cd89807e56:0

value
2851675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ed6e362223f686b588a07870061c095687519f5a OP_EQUAL
address
3PLS6diqZ4tRHqtoFzvxPp3ZuDKnfzDpBA
transaction
3595169e2271f77326251626e8356665ccbd6aade5078a9874e678cd89807e56
spent
true